Articles of webkit

Android Browser – Javascript window.innerWidth возвращает неправильное значение

Я использую веб-браузер по умолчанию для Android G1, и я развиваюсь в JavaScript – мне трудно получить реальную визуальную ширину и высоту, когда я увеличиваю или уменьшаю масштаб на веб-странице. Кажется, что я получаю неправильное значение из window.innerWidth, когда я увеличиваю / уменьшаю. То, что я пытаюсь сделать, – показать элемент на визуальном фиксированном месте, […]

Альтернативы window.scrollMaxY?

Я пытаюсь использовать window.pageYOffset & window.scrollMaxY для вычисления текущего прогресса страницы. Этот подход работает под FF3.5, но в окне webkit.scrollMaxY не определено.

Получить последний загруженный URL-адрес веб-обозревателя без использования webView.goBack () в Android

Я хочу зарегистрировать URL-адрес истории или последний загруженный URL-адрес без ручного хранения URL-адресов истории. Это возможно?

Странное поведение в браузере Android при выборе полей

Браузер Android Webkit (проверенный на 2.2, 2.3 и 3.0), кажется, ведет себя странно, когда модальные элементы ставятся один над другим. В этом примере здесь … Я показываю jQuery UI date picker с z-index 200, серый оверлей div, охватывающий всю высоту и ширину документа с z-index 199 и за всем, что является обычной формой. В приведенном […]

Есть ли способ удалить щелчок на мобильных устройствах Touch Touch?

При просмотре веб-сайта на мобильном устройстве (iPad, Galaxy Tab) всегда происходит отставание, когда я нажимаю элемент (регулярная ссылка или что-то еще, что можно сделать с помощью javascript / jquery). Читая онлайн, я узнал, что браузер использует touchstart, за которым следуют события touchhend, а затем запускает обычный клик. Есть ли способ получить более отзывчивый ответ и […]

Что делает -webkit-text-size-adjust?

Я пытаюсь понять использование -webkit-text-size-adjust:none; , Добавление / удаление, которое не влияет на размеры моего шрифта на Android (хром) или iOS (сафари и хром). Так в чем польза?

Неверная ширина в браузере веб-браузера Android

Я заметил проблему с браузером по умолчанию для Android, где 100% -ная ширина действительно может пройти мимо края экрана. Вот минимальный тестовый пример: <div class='separator' width=100% style='border: 2px;padding: 2px;border-style: solid;'>&nbsp;</div> <div class='separator' width=100% style='border: 2px;padding: 2px;border-style: solid;'>New & improved div</div> <div class='separator' width=100% style='border: 2px;padding: 2px;border-style: solid;'>another working one</div> <div class='separator' width=100% style='border: 2px;padding: 2px;border-style: […]

WebView вызывает SQLiteDiskIOException

Я получаю сообщения о SQLiteDiskIOExceptions в течение некоторого времени (через Flurry / acra). Я не смог воспроизвести проблему локально, но это мой самый частый сбой, который случается раз в пятьдесят сеансов в плохой день. Они, кажется, особенно часто встречаются под Android 2.3.x. Я абсолютно не использую SQL в своем собственном коде, но у меня одновременно […]

Android :: Webview удаляет полосу прокрутки для DIV

Я сделал небольшую веб-страницу с прокручиваемым div. Когда я загружаю его в браузере, он отлично работает. Но когда я загружаю его в webview внутри Android, он не позволяет мне прокручивать div. Есть ли обходной путь для этого или я должен использовать другой дизайн? Я говорю о таких сайтах.

Флеш анимации CSS3 на Android 2.2 (webkit-transform: translate (..) scale (..) в то же время)

Я провел некоторое исследование по Android о анимации CSS3 (преобразование с помощью webkit-перехода). Анимация CSS3 все еще является экспериментальной функцией в Webkit. Если вы попытаетесь одновременно выполнить перевод и масштабирование, вы найдете несколько сбоев и / или ошибок в анимации CSS (например, см. Http://www.youtube.com/watch?v=vZdBVzN1B8Y ). Другими словами, во многих версиях Android свойство -webkit-transform: matrix (…) […]